Panel a contains an input layer with Bias, C S R at N R I 50.8 per cent, G I C at N R I 74.7 per cent, G T L at N R I 87.6 per cent, and S P at N R I 100 per cent. The sigmoid hidden layer contains Bias, H 1 1, H 1 2, and H 1 3. Bias has negative weights to all 3 hidden nodes. C S R, G I C, and S P have positive weights to the 3 hidden nodes. G T L has positive weights to H 1 1 and H 1 2, and a negative weight to H 1 3. Hidden Bias, H 1 1, and H 1 3 have positive weights to G H R M, while H 1 2 has a negative weight. The output signal applies sigmoid activation. Panel b contains Bias and G H R M as inputs, with G H R M carrying beta 0.570. The sigmoid hidden layer contains Bias, H 1 1, and H 1 2. Bias has negative weights to both hidden nodes, while G H R M has positive weights to both. Hidden Bias, H 1 1, and H 1 2 have positive weights to C S P. The output signal applies sigmoid activation. Solid connections denote positive weights, and broken connections denote negative weights.(a) ANN Model 1 – Architecture for Predicting GHRM (b) ANN Model 2 – Architecture for Predicting CSP from GHRM
